Uncovering the mystery of the failure of the Sino-Japanese War, did Cixi misappropriate the military expenses of the Beiyang Navy?

In fact, Empress Dowager Cixi did not misappropriate the military expenses of Beiyang Navy, but she certainly had to bear a great responsibility for the failure of the Sino-Japanese War, because Empress Dowager Cixi misappropriated the money donated by Haiphong. In addition, in order to rebuild the Summer Palace, Guangxu's biological father also misappropriated the funds of the naval yamen.

In fact, by the end of the Qing Dynasty, the whole Qing Dynasty had experienced many wars, such as the Opium War, the Sino-Japanese War, and some domestic insurgents. During the Taiping Heavenly Kingdom, there was a Westernization Movement in China, and at this time, the Qing court began to slowly develop its own water army. Before that, the Qing court actually had no defense against the sea. 1888, Beiyang navy was formally established. At this time, the Qing court also invested 1 100 million silver. Although Beiyang Navy had been established at this time, the Qing court could not fully understand the actual role of the navy, and the partisan struggle within the Qing court was also very serious at that time, so Beiyang Navy actually did not receive much money every year.

Before the Sino-Japanese War broke out, the Qing court made donations in the name of naval battles. The money raised at that time was also very large. Unfortunately, the money was not really given to Beiyang Navy. Part of it was used to build the Summer Palace, and part of it was deposited by Cixi in western banks. In other words, the imperial court at that time actually donated in the name of Beiyang Navy.

The Yoshino ship used by the Japanese in the Sino-Japanese War of 1894-1895 was actually customized by the Qing Dynasty at first, and later, due to lack of funds, Britain resold it to Japan. In the Sino-Japanese War of 1894- 1895, this Yoshino ship also played a very important role. If Empress Dowager Cixi can give all the money raised to the Beiyang Navy, then this Yoshino ship belongs to our Beiyang Navy.
